PBS NORTH CAROLINA ANNOUNCES NEW SEASON OF ‘SIDE BY SIDE WITH NIDO QUBEIN’ 

Industry leaders—including Coach Roy Williams, Chef Vivian Howard and Netflix Cofounder Marc Randolph—discuss their personal journeys with Dr. Nido Qubein. 

RESEARCH TRIANGLE PARK, NC, 10/3/2022 — PBS North Carolina announces season two of its original series Side by Side with Nido Qubein. Each week, Dr. Qubein sits down with an influential leader from the world of culture, politics, business and technology in an engaging conversation about innovation and resilience. The new season premieres Tuesday, October 4, at 7 PM, on PBS NC and the PBS Video App with a one-on-one with legendary college basketball coach Roy Williams. Other guests this season include ESPN anchor Sage Steele, Netflix cofounder Marc Randolph, Greensboro Mayor Nancy Vaughan, chef and TV personality Vivian Howard, Simply Southern founder Ginger Aydogdu, STEM educator Steve Spangler and KIND founder and executive Daniel Lubetzky. 

In addition to serving as president of High Point University (HPU), Dr. Qubein is a successful author and sought-after professional speaker. As host of HPU’s Access to Innovators series, he interviewed such notable guests as Secretaries of State Dr. Condoleezza Rice and General Colin Powell, Apple cofounder Steve Wozniak, writer Malcolm Gladwell and veteran newscaster Tom Brokaw. In season 1 of Side by Sidewith Nido Qubein, Dr.Qubein conversed with a variety of leaders, including consultant and philanthropist Dr. Robert Brown, ABC News anchor Byron Pitts, US Army Captain Charlie Plumb and Dallas Mavericks CEO Cynt Marshall. 

“PBS NC shares valuable and inspiring stories with viewers throughout our state and beyond,” says Nido Qubein. “Side by Side is proud to showcase many of those inspiring stories and we are grateful for the enthusiastic response we’ve received from our viewers and supporters.” 

Funding for Side by Side with Nido Qubein is made possible by Coca-Cola Consolidated, Inc., The Budd Group and Ashley Home Store.

About the Host 

Nido Qubein immigrated to the United States from the Middle East as a teenager in search of a college education. He supported himself through college, attending Mount Olive College, then High Point University to receive his bachelor’s degree and the University of North Carolina at Greensboro for graduate studies. His entrepreneurial spirit and work ethic led him to a variety of business ventures and leadership positions with Truist Financial Corporation, La-Z Boy Corporation, Great Harvest Bread Company and nThrive. He has served on the board of several national organizations and, since 2005, as the president of High Point University. About PBS North Carolina 

As North Carolina’s statewide PBS network serving the country’s third largest public media market, PBS North Carolina educates, informs, entertains and inspires its audience on air, online and in person. Through its unique partnership of public investment and private support, the network includes in-person engagement, digital-first social and online content delivery and four over-the-air channels: PBS NC, the North Carolina Channel, Rootle 24/7 PBS Kids and the Explorer Channel. Its transformational events and content spark curiosity and wonder for all North Carolinians. Additionally, PBS NC serves as the backbone for North Carolina’s state emergency services.
